CES 2026 Kicks Off in Las Vegas with Groundbreaking Innovations
The annual Consumer Electronics Show (CES) has officially begun in Las Vegas, showcasing a plethora of cutting-edge technologies. Major players like Nvidia, AMD, and Samsung are at the forefront, with a strong emphasis on AI integrations and self-driving vehicle advancements. Attendees can explore an array of innovative gadgets, including AI-driven robots, an exoskeleton, and an AI beauty mirror. As technology enthusiasts flock to the event, highlights from Day 1 reveal everything from smart glasses to foldable phones, with a focus on how artificial intelligence is reshaping the tech landscape. Experts and executives are engaging in discussions about the future of AI, its implications for automation, and the evolving automotive sector.
